What has to be true for corresponding angles to be congruent ​

Answer:

The lines intersected by a transversal must be parallel.

What is the x-coordinate of the vertex of the parabola whose equation is y = 3x2 + 9x?
inn [45]
Hello :
y = 3x²+9x
   = 3(x² + 3x )
   = 3 ( x² +2(3/2)x +(3/2)²) -(3/2)²)
   = 3((x+3/2)² -9/4)
y = 3 (x+3/2)² -27/4
<span>the x-coordinate of the vertex  is : - 3/2</span>
